Charlotte Independence owner selling stake after COVID-19 conspiracy tweets – The Athletic

Charlotte Independence majority owner Dan DiMicco is selling his stake in the club, the United Soccer League announced Monday.

DiMicco, who served as trade adviser to Donald Trump during his 2016 presidential campaign, has been criticized for regularly tweeting conspiracy theories about the origin of COVID-19 in China.

“The day-to-day management of the club — of which Mr. DiMicco and others are not directly involved — will continue to be overseen by President and Managing Partner Jim McPhilliamy,” the USL said in a statement. “As such, the Club remains fully committed to all players, staff and community members as we move forward with the 2021 season and beyond.”
